Gender identity refers to a person's deeply felt, internal sense of being male, female, non-binary, or another gender. Transgender individuals have a gender identity that differs from the sex they were assigned at birth. Cisgender individuals have a gender identity that aligns with their assigned sex at birth. In conclusion, the transgender community is not a subset of LGBTQ culture; it is its beating heart and its horizon. Historically, trans activists lit the match for Stonewall. Philosophically, trans experiences have expanded the lexicon of identity from a focus on orientation to a deeper understanding of the self. Culturally, trans art and resistance have infused queer spaces with resilience. To separate the trans community from LGBTQ culture is to misunderstand the nature of queerness itself: a perpetual rebellion against the idea that who we are and who we love can be neatly boxed in. As long as the transgender community fights for the right to simply exist, they will remain the conscience of LGBTQ culture, reminding the world that freedom is not just the right to marry, but the right to be authentically, unapologetically oneself.

While a gay person can typically present their driver’s license without fear of it causing violence (though their identity may still be targeted), a trans person whose ID does not match their gender presentation faces a constant, dangerous risk. Changing one’s name and legal gender marker is a bureaucratic maze. The fight for “X” gender markers on passports and IDs is a fight led entirely by trans and non-binary advocates.
